If you don’t know what cycle speedway is, it’s an odd form of bike racing, held on a short (80m or so), flat, cinder track. Bikes are a little like track bikes, but with sit up and beg handlebars, a single freewheel – oh, and no brakes whatsoever… The idea is to race round this track four times and the winner is the first over the line. A lap is only about ten seconds, so a race is over in under a minute. It’s not necessarily about flat out speed either as if you go too fast, then you won’t make the next corner (no brakes, remember?) – and I’ve been soundly beaten in the past by a 12 year old and a pensioner, just due to them racing strategically (i.e. always being where the rest of us wanted to be…)
